The leads in the Civil War epic ``Cold Mountain,'' Nicole Kidman and Jude Law, were passed over for SAG nominations, but co-star Renee Zellweger received a nod in the supporting category. Zellweger was last year's lead actress winner for ``Chicago'' but lost the Oscar to Kidman, who won for ``The Hours.'' O'Neil, author of the book ``Movie Awards,'' said that with Oscar ballots due on Saturday, the SAG nods for Depp, Dinklage, Watts and Wood could be especially helpful at this late stage. He noted that Halle Berry began a late rally two years ago by winning the SAG award, then later the Oscar for ``Monster's Ball,'' over early awards season favorite Sissy Spacek (``In the Bedroom''). The entire casts of ``In America,'' ``The Lord of the Rings: The Return of the King,'' ``Mystic River,'' ``Seabiscuit'' and ``The Station Agent'' were nominated for outstanding performance by a cast. Also on the television side, not only was the entire cast of ``Everybody Loves Raymond'' nominated for outstanding comedy series ensemble, but nearly everybody was nominated individually, including Ray Romano, Patricia Heaton, Brad Garrett, Doris Roberts and Peter Boyle. It was the first individual SAG nomination for Roberts, a three-time Emmy winner. The ``Raymond'' cast is pitted against the casts of ``Frasier,'' ``Friends,'' ``Sex and the City'' and ``Will & Grace.'' No ``Sex'' stars were nominated individually, while Lisa Kudrow was the only ``Friends'' cast member to receive a solo nod, her fourth overall. For drama, ``The West Wing'' led the nominations with four, including individual mentions for Martin Sheen, Stockard Channing and Allison Janney.
